package database
import (
"encoding/json"
"errors"
"fmt"
"time"
"github.com/aws/aws-sdk-go/aws"
"github.com/aws/aws-sdk-go/aws/session"
"github.com/aws/aws-sdk-go/service/rds"
)
const (
dbClusterEndpointType = "db-cluster-endpoint-type"
WriterEndPointType = "writer"
ReaderEndpointType = "reader"
)
type rdsAPI interface {
DescribeDBClusterEndpoints(input *rds.DescribeDBClusterEndpointsInput) (*rds.DescribeDBClusterEndpointsOutput, error)
DescribeDBInstances(input *rds.DescribeDBInstancesInput) (*rds.DescribeDBInstancesOutput, error)
}
type awsRDS struct {
client rdsAPI
}
// NewRds accepts an rdsAPI interface and returns an awsRDS.
func NewRds(client rdsAPI) *awsRDS { //nolint:revive
if client != nil {
return &awsRDS{client: client}
}
// Initialize a session in us-east-1 that the SDK will use to load
// credentials from the shared credentials file ~/.aws/credentials //todo pull from env
sess, err := session.NewSession(&aws.Config{
Region: aws.String("us-east-1"),
})
if err != nil {
panic(err)
}
// Create RDS service client
svc := rds.New(sess)
return &awsRDS{client: svc}
}
// DescribeEndpoint will return information for a provisioned RDS instance using the cluster name
// and type.
func (r *awsRDS) DescribeEndpoint(clusterName string, epType string) ([]byte, error) {
filters := []*rds.Filter{
{
Name: aws.String(dbClusterEndpointType),
Values: aws.StringSlice([]string{epType}),
},
}
output, err := r.client.DescribeDBClusterEndpoints(&rds.DescribeDBClusterEndpointsInput{
DBClusterIdentifier: aws.String(clusterName),
Filters: filters,
})
if err != nil {
err := fmt.Errorf("unable to describe endpoint, %w", err)
return nil, err
}
b, err := json.Marshal(&output)
if err != nil {
err := fmt.Errorf("error marshalling json, %w", err)
return nil, err
}
return b, nil
}
// DescribeAllEndpoints returns the URL for all provisioned RDS instances and filters on type
// epType can be either a "writer" or a "reader".
func (r *awsRDS) DescribeAllEndpoints(epType string) ([]byte, error) {
endpoints := make([]*rds.DBClusterEndpoint, 0)
result, err := r.client.DescribeDBInstances(nil)
if err != nil {
err := fmt.Sprintf("unable to list instances, %v", err)
return nil, errors.New(err)
}
filters := []*rds.Filter{
{
Name: aws.String(dbClusterEndpointType),
Values: aws.StringSlice([]string{epType}),
},
}
for _, d := range result.DBInstances {
output, err := r.client.DescribeDBClusterEndpoints(&rds.DescribeDBClusterEndpointsInput{
DBClusterIdentifier: d.DBClusterIdentifier,
Filters: filters,
})
if err != nil {
err := fmt.Sprintf("unable to describe endpoints, %v", err)
return nil, errors.New(err)
}
endpoints = append(endpoints, output.DBClusterEndpoints[0])
}
b, err := json.Marshal(&endpoints)
if err != nil {
err := fmt.Errorf("error marshalling json, %w", err)
return nil, err
}
return b, nil
}
type instance struct {
Identifier string `json:"identifier"`
CreatedAt time.Time `json:"createdAt"`
}
// ListDBIdentifiers Returns the identifier and created date/time for provisioned RDS instances.
// This method does not currently support pagination. However, the AWS API does.
func (r *awsRDS) ListDBIdentifiers() ([]byte, error) {
/*
to := make([]string, len(s.To))
for i, t := range s.To {
to[i] = t.String()
}
*/
var inst instance
instances := make([]instance, 0)
result, err := r.client.DescribeDBInstances(nil)
if err != nil {
err := fmt.Sprintf("unable to list instances, %v", err)
return nil, errors.New(err)
}
for _, d := range result.DBInstances {
if err != nil {
err := fmt.Sprintf("unable to describe endpoints, %v", err)
return nil, errors.New(err)
}
inst.Identifier = aws.StringValue(d.DBInstanceIdentifier)
inst.CreatedAt = aws.TimeValue(d.InstanceCreateTime)
instances = append(instances, inst)
}
b, err := json.Marshal(&instances)
if err != nil {
err := fmt.Errorf("error marshalling json, %w", err)
return nil, err
}
return b, nil
}
